26 /*
27  * Mbox events
28  *
29  * The event mechanism is based on a pair of event buffers (buffers A and
30  * B) at fixed locations in the target's memory. The host processes one
31  * buffer while the other buffer continues to collect events. If the host
32  * is not processing events, an interrupt is issued to signal that a buffer
33  * is ready. Once the host is done with processing events from one buffer,
34  * it signals the target (with an ACK interrupt) that the event buffer is
35  * free.
36  */
